NEW PRODUCT INFORMATION

The SD14, 14 megapixels (2,652×1,768×3 layers) Digital SLR camera

The Sigma Corporation is pleased to announce the launch of the new Sigma SD14

Digital SLR camera.

The new SD14, powered by the 14 megapixels Foveon X3

®

direct-image-sensor, can

reproduce high definition images rich in gradation and impressive three-dimensional detail.

The SD14 Digital SLR camera features four JPEG recording modes, large and bright

pentaprism viewfinder with 98% coverage, a built-in flash with a Guide Number of 11,

5-point AF system, a large 2.5” 150,000 pixel resolution LCD monitor as well as high

resolution and user friendly design. The durable shutter mechanism has over 100,000 cycle

life and is ideal for the demands of digital photography.





Development

Sigma introduced its first digital SLR camera, the SD9, to the market in October 2002,

and has established strong support from a wide range of photographers both amateur and

professional alike. The second model, the SD10, released on to the market in November

2003 continued to build on the support of loyal photographers. However, demand for

JPEG’s greater convenience in image handling has increased and in order to meet this

demand the new SD14, powered by Foveon X3

®

direct image sensor, now includes JPEG

mode with high image quality, high performance and versatility.
